9th Mile or Shooting Point is one of best attractions in India. Its somewhere 9-10 Kms from ooty on the way to Pykara Lake.The climbing on the shooting spot is quite steep and one can either climb on foot or hire a horse ride. After crossing over this relatively small Kamraji Sagar dam, we reached the famous Shooting Point. We took a halt of 30 minutes at this point.
